Public title Rectal misoprostol versus intravenous tranexamic acid as an adjunct to tourniquet during abdominal myomectomy: A randomized controlled trial
Official scientific title Rectal misoprostol versus intravenous tranexamic acid as an adjunct to tourniquet during abdominal myomectomy: A randomized controlled trial
Brief summary describing the background and objectives of the trial Uterine fibroids are the most common non-cancerous growths in the female reproductive system worldwide. Abdominal myomectomy remains a key fertility-preserving surgical option for women with symptomatic uterine fibroids, particularly in resource-limited settings. However, significant intraoperative blood loss is a major complication that often necessitates blood transfusion and increases perioperative morbidity. Therefore, implementing strategies to minimize bleeding during myomectomy is essential to reducing the associated morbidity and mortality and ultimately improving patient outcomes. Application of tourniquets to occlude the peri-cervical uterine arteries have been used to reduce intra-operative blood loss, however adjunctive pharmacological agents such as misoprostol or tranexamic acid (TXA) have been noted to further enhance hemostasis, reduce operative morbidity and improve surgical outcomes. While both agents are individually effective when used in combination with tourniquets, there are limited available data or fewer studies directly comparing the efficacy and safety of these agents when used as an adjunct during myomectomy. This study aims to generate comparative data on the effectiveness and safety of two widely available and cost-effective pharmacological agents, potentially guiding clinical decision-making in minimizing blood loss during myomectomy

INTERVENTIONS
Intervention type Intervention name Dose Duration Intervention description Group size Nature of control
Control Group Intravenous Tranexamic acid 1000mg Administered thirty minutes before surgery Tranexamic acid is an anti-fibrinolytic agent which works by reversibly inhibiting the activation of plasmin and preventing breakdown of fibrin in blood clots. This stabilizes blood clots, thus reducing excessive bleeding during surgery without impairing coagulation cascade. 53 Active-Treatment of Control Group
Experimental Group Rectal misoprostol 400mcg Administered 1hour before surgery Misoprostol is a prostaglandin E1 analogue which is widely used in obstetrics for the treatment and prevention of postpartum haemorrhage, may decrease intra-operative bleeding in abdominal myomectomies. 53

OUTCOMES
Type of outcome Outcome Timepoint(s) at which outcome measured
Primary Outcome Intraoperative estimated blood loss (EBL) will be measured using both gravimetric and volumetric method immediate postoperative
Secondary Outcome Change in the haematocrit (Hct) from preoperative baseline to 24hours post-operative Need for blood transfusion: number of patients receiving intra-operative or postoperative transfusion and the total units of blood transfused per patient Operative time: from skin incision to closure of the skin (mins) Length of hospital stay Adverse drug reaction vis-Ă -vis nausea, vomiting,diarrhoea, fever, chills and rigor, thromboembolic event, allergic reaction and seizure 48hours

Yes I will committed to transparent research and plan to share de-identified individual participant data (IPD) collected during this trial. The shared dataset will include baseline demographics and all primary and secondary clinical outcomes—specifically, estimated blood loss, perioperative haematocrit levels, transfusion requirements, and any recorded adverse events. To fully contextualize the data, I will also provide the full study protocol, the Statistical Analysis Plan (SAP), and the blank Informed Consent Form (ICF). This data package will be made available 1year following the publication of our primary results (giving our team time to finalize secondary analyses) and will remain accessible for a period of 3 years. Informed Consent Form,Study Protocol 1year to 2years post publication To protect participant privacy, data access is strictly controlled. Here is how we manage requests: Who can apply: Access is reserved exclusively for qualified researchers affiliated with recognized academic, clinical, or public health institutions. Allowed uses: The data may only be used for methodologically sound secondary research, such as verifying our primary outcomes or incorporating the data into larger systematic reviews and meta-analyses. Commercial use, unapproved post-hoc analyses, or any attempt to re-identify participants is strictly prohibited. The request process: Interested researchers must submit a formal proposal detailing their scientific hypothesis and analysis plan. This proposal will be evaluated by our study's Data Access Committee (including the PI, a biostatistician, and an ethics representative) for scientific merit. Final requirements: Before any data is securely transferred, approved applicants must provide proof of independent ethical (IRB/HREC) approval for their specific analysis and sign a legally binding Data Use Agreement (DUA) to ensure strict adherence to data protection laws.
